Water

Top-loading washers require an impeller or agitator to push soap and water through the clothing, causing mechanical wear and abrasion. Front-loaders, on the other hand, use paddles that gently lift and drop clothing inside a spinning drum to clean, reducing wear. The amount of lint in dryer lint filter can be used to estimate the rate of wear.
